If you ask me what my favorite chocolate is, hands down I’d tell you: Toblerone. The silky milk chocolate with the nougat chips throughout… it’s like biting into heaven. So when I decided to turn the average chocolate chip cookie into Toblerone Cookies, it was love at first bite.
Ingredients:
1 cup of butter, soften
1 tsp salt
1 tsp baking soda
2 eggs
2 1/2 cups all purpose flour
1 1/2 tsp vanilla
1 cup light brown sugar
1/2 cup white sugar
two 3.5 oz bars of Toblerone
In the bowl of your mixer, mix together the butter, eggs, brown sugar, white sugar, and vanilla. Beat them together until the mixture comes together.
In a separate bowl, sift together the flour, salt and baking soda. Once the wet mixture is combined, slowly add in the flour mix until all is combined.
Chop up the chocolate into slivers and mix into the batter. Chill in the refrigerator for about an hour before baking.
Scoop out small (tablespoon) amounts onto a baking sheet, and bake at 350 degree for 10-12 minutes until edges are golden brown and center is set.

Although you can use a stand mixer, a handheld mixer is perfectly fine, too.
I will warn you – these cookies are addictive. You may want to freeze half of the dough in small scoops to avoid eating them all at once. And bonus, you’ll have some for later.
